-
Notifications
You must be signed in to change notification settings - Fork 432
Open
Labels
area/release-engIssues or PRs related to the Release Engineering subprojectIssues or PRs related to the Release Engineering subprojectkind/documentationCategorizes issue or PR as related to documentation.Categorizes issue or PR as related to documentation.priority/important-soonMust be staffed and worked on either currently, or very soon, ideally in time for the next release.Must be staffed and worked on either currently, or very soon, ideally in time for the next release.sig/releaseCategorizes an issue or PR as relevant to SIG Release.Categorizes an issue or PR as relevant to SIG Release.
Milestone
Description
As a follow up on: #2916 (comment)
Tasks
- Create a thread in #release-management: https://kubernetes.slack.com/archives/CJH2GBF7Y/p1764683565451229
- (optional) Remove jobs for EOL versions, only if agreed upon with Release Managers - drop v1.31 jobs due to EOL test-infra#35999
- Update
milestone_applierrules - add milestone applier rules for 1.35, remove 1.31 test-infra#36000 - Update
kubekins-e2e-v2/variants.yamlwith the new version config - add kubekins-e2e-v2 variants for v1.35 test-infra#36002 - built new imagesgcr.io/k8s-staging-test-infra/kubekins-e2e:v20251202-27e1f5f482-1.35gcr.io/k8s-staging-test-infra/kubekins-e2e:latest-1.35 - Rotate configuration of release branch jobs in kubernetes/test-infra in particular
releng/test_config.yamlfor the upcoming release - update test config for v1.35 test-infra#36005 - Run test generation script, configure the new release dashboards and send a PR with both tests and dashboards config - Generate v1.35 testgrid jobs test-infra#36018 (fix images fix images for v1.35 jobs test-infra#36023)
- Add a new variant for the
kube-crossimage (kubernetes/releaserepository) and ensure the image is built and pushed properly - noop, image for v1.35 already exists - Add new variants for
k8s-cloud-builderandk8s-ci-builderimages (kubernetes/releaserepository) and ensure images are built and pushed properly - noop, k8s-cloud-builder v1.35 already exists, k8s-ci-builder v1.35 already exists - Update references in
kubernetes/kuberneteswith the new kube-cross image (only after all images are pushed/promoted) -- noop, already done - Update publishing-bot rules to include the new release branch - add release-1.35 publishing bot rules kubernetes#135553
- Ensure that a new performance tests branch is created by SIG Scalability maintainers - Create new branch release-1.35 for Kubernetes v1.35 perf-tests#3703
- Inform stakeholders about the post branch creation tasks being completed
- Monitor the new release dashboard with the Release Signal Lead for at least 48 hours - mainly for missing or misconfigured jobs
Action Items
Open Questions
/milestone v1.35
/assign @neoaggelos
/cc @kubernetes/release-managers @kubernetes/release-team-release-signal
/priority important-soon
/kind documentation
Metadata
Metadata
Assignees
Labels
area/release-engIssues or PRs related to the Release Engineering subprojectIssues or PRs related to the Release Engineering subprojectkind/documentationCategorizes issue or PR as related to documentation.Categorizes issue or PR as related to documentation.priority/important-soonMust be staffed and worked on either currently, or very soon, ideally in time for the next release.Must be staffed and worked on either currently, or very soon, ideally in time for the next release.sig/releaseCategorizes an issue or PR as relevant to SIG Release.Categorizes an issue or PR as relevant to SIG Release.